BROOKLINE, NH — A Milford man was killed Tuesday night in a two-vehicle crash involving a motorcycle and a pickup truck on Route 13, according to Brookline police.

Emergency crews responded to the scene shortly after 8:30 p.m. following reports of a collision between a Harley-Davidson motorcycle and a Ford F-250 pickup truck. Police said the motorcyclist, identified as Joshua Christiana, 39, who was traveling south on Route 13 and attempting to turn into a driveway, was struck from behind by the pickup truck, driven by Jean-Paul Doiron, 33, of Brookline.

Doiron reportedly rendered first aid to Christiana until first responders arrived. Christiana was transported by Brookline Ambulance to a hospital in Nashua, where he was later pronounced dead. Doiron was not injured in the crash.

Route 13 was closed for several hours Tuesday night as investigators examined the scene.

This marks the 30th person killed on New Hampshire roads so far this year.

No charges have been filed at this time, and the crash remains under investigation. Police are asking anyone with information about the incident to contact the Brookline Police Department at 603-673-3755.
